== Workflow interpreter and processor

    flow.rb is a utility for running job workflows in
    DRMAA-compliant DRM systems. Workflows are specified in
    flowfiles that allow expression of

      * concurrent and sequencial execution of sub-flows
      * multiple runs of sub-flows with varying parameter sets
      * acutal jobs are defined in terms of DRMAA attributes

    in addition any subflow or sets of subflows can be run
    as used with make(1) by specifying it as target.

=== Job defaults

    To minimize the extend attributes necessarily to be
    specified in flowfiles, flow.rb provides defaults for
    jobs command path, stdout/stdin path, current working
    directory and job name.

=== Workflow verification

    The -verify option can be used to print dependencies and
    job attributes for diagnosis purposes and to ensure each
    workflow job can be run, a number of verifications is
    performed before the first job gets submitted.

=== Job streaming

    Large workflows are automatically run in job streaming
    mode upon DRM saturation and a job maximum can be used
    to set in .flowrc.rb an upper limit of job concurrently
    be kept in the DRM for each workflow.

=== Pre-submission plug-in

    Enforcement of site-specific policies can easily be
    achieved through pre-submission procedures that allow
    any job attribute freely be modified.
